We analyze what France, Britain, and Canada were saying -- with specific fine print -- when they declared they would recognize a notional State of Palestine soon. In context, you can hear Prime Ministers Starmer (UK) and Carney (Canada).
Our guest, Jonathan Schanzer of FDD, outlines his idea of letting plenty of food into Gaza -- because "this news cycle for Israel has been brutal" -- but refuse to let any cement or construction materials in. Gaza would lie in ruins, and the Palestinians may well turn against Hamas. Rather than argue about charges of famine or inadequate food supplies, Schanzer says, "Perception is reality. ... Israel needs to change the channel. ... The tone is shifting, even among Israel's friends."
